On 01/08/2021 00:51, antispam@math.uni.wroc.pl wrote: > Bart <bc@freeuk.com> wrote: >> A CALL to another function normally uses a relative offset. You can't >> just extract functions and move them about without invalidating those >> offsets. And doing that requires being able to precisely track what is >> code and what is data (even in executable memory). > > Do you know what position-independent code means? I know what I mean by it. Which is the ability to relocate a contiguous block of code at any address, and internal references /within/ the code still work. But not to move parts of it separately. (I think this was discussed on comp.lang.misc recently.) > And what static > linking means? In the current context, whether an external library's code is incorporated into the executable you're building. Otherwise it's accessed as a shared library with fixups done when the program is loaded for execution. >> (DLL files will have that info, but are intended for moving the entirely >> library, not individual blocks of functions or data.) > > Yes, Windows i386 DLL-s used static linking with relocation info > for adjusting start address of library at load time. And relocation > was applied to the whole library. This is very unlike what ELF > on Linux is doing: Linux shared libraries need position-independent > code, unlike i386 Windows DLL-s. IIUC also 64-bit Windows DLL > work like Linux ones and need position-independent code. Actually there is no such restriction on 64-bit DLLs. The only requirement is that absolute addresses within the code are part of the relocation table. (At least, /I/ don't bother with PIC, it's all mixed, and the DLL files I write seem to work.) >> This is nonsense, at least for COFF files. Tell me whereabouts function >> sizes are stored in that file format. It can only infer the sizes by >> analysing the start addresses of all the functions, and then it might be >> stuck on the last one, or where data is intermingled. > > I do not understand your fixation on function size. Linker works > with sections and relocates sections as a whole. If you want > functions than use '-ffunction-sections', then section size > will be the same as function size.
